The Lake Tahoe South Shore Chamber of Commerce is pleased to announce a Public Workshop for Jan. 30 at Inn by the Lake at 6 p.m. The purpose of the workshop is to solicit input from the community to help design the Wayfinding project.
<b>The Project:</b> The Lake Tahoe South Shore Chamber of Commerce has been awarded funding from the City of South Lake Tahoe City Council and El Dorado County Board of Supervisors to manage a Wayfinding project to benefit the South Shore Community. The goal of the project will be to design and install engaging, intuitive clear and safe set of signs with a consistent and visual identity from beginning to end to enhance the visitor's experience by easily directing them to places they would like to visit. As a result, the visitor will more easily navigate the community and be more likely to observe civic, cultural, commercial, conference, lodging and recreational amenities they might not otherwise have noticed.
<b>Design Workshop: Project Design Consultant:</b> The Public Workshop will be attended by the Design Workshop, Consultant for the project. Design Workshop is a local design firm selected from six proposals received for the project. Design Workshop has experience working with the basin's government regulatory agencies and years of experience serving the south shore community.
